In the past 5 years, however, oclacitinib (Apoquel; ), a Janus kinase (JAK) inhibitor, has become another important drug in the management of allergic pruritus. There are 4 JAK families in mammals: JAK1, JAK2, JAK3, and TYK2. Oclacitinib preferably inhibits JAK1 and, to a lesser degree, JAK3, resulting in decreased activity of JAK1-dependent cytokines involved in allergy and inflammation (IL-2, IL-4, IL-6, and IL-13) as well as pruritus (IL-31). Since oclacitinib is a rather weak anti-inflammatory drug, it was suggested that remission of active moderate to severe atopic dermatitis be induced with a course of a broad inflammation-targeting drug, such as a short-acting glucocorticoid, until clinical signs become mild.
